Felix Wong, a biotech entrepreneur with Massachusetts roots, chose to establish his company in Silicon Valley rather than Boston due to better access to funding, resources, and investor support. Despite Boston’s strong biotech history and local talent, rising costs, high taxes, and a less risk-tolerant investment environment have prompted startups like Wong’s Integrated Biosciences to relocate westward. This trend contributes to concerns about Boston losing its early-stage biotech innovation ecosystem and highlights a growing regional rivalry for scientific and entrepreneurial leadership.
